Job Positions of Data Manager A1/A2 at Rulindo District (RULINDO)

Job responsibilities

  • Ensure timeliness, accuracy, completeness of data collected at the health facilities
  • Supervise and provide instructions for workers collecting and tabulating data.
  • Collection, analysis, interpretation and production of hospital Statistics
  • Report results of statistical analyses, including information in the form of graphs, charts, and tables.
  • Consolidate statistical reports from different services/departments and projects operating under hospital.
  • Provide reports of birth, death audit, disease surveillance and other HMIS reports to the supervisors
  • Data entry and actively participate in internal and external data quality assessment
  • Supervise health centers in the catchment area to verify the reliability and quality of data.
  • Participate in hospital operational research and monitoring& evaluation activity
  • Perform other related duties as required by his/her supervisor
